Specifications & Maintenance

The main syringe needle specifications are capacity, material, and design. This includes the kind of needles and how they work together. These are some of the common specifications with descriptions.

  • Needle Gauge and Size

    Needles come in many gauges. The gauge decides the thickness of the needle. Higher gauges, like 25 or 27, are thinner. Lower gauges, like 18 or 21, are thicker. Thicker needles inject drugs faster. Thinner needles hurt less when giving shots.

  • Syringe Capacity

    Syringes hold different amounts of milliliters (ml). Common sizes are 1ml, 3ml, 5ml, 10ml, 20ml, 30ml, and 60ml. A 3ml syringe with a 25 gauge needle is perfect for giving shots in arms and thighs. For smaller doses, a 1-ml insulin syringe is better.

  • Safety Features

    Some syringes have added safety options. These can help stop needle stick injuries. Common features are shielding the needle after the shot or hiding it from view. Other devices have the needle built in, making them safer to use.

Applications of Syringe Needles

Surrounded by the healthcare profession's strict standards and protocols, the usage scenario of syringe needles is predominantly confined to medical settings and health care industries. However, the applications are vast and diverse.

  • Vaccinations: Syringe needles, particularly those with needles that may not damage the body, are used for vaccinations against diseases ranging from the flu to more specialized vaccines, such as for yellow fever, etc. Mass vaccination campaigns, such as those conducted during outbreaks or for protected childhood immunizations, rely on efficient and safe syringe needles. Syringe needle exporters can help supply these syringes for use in these campaigns.
  • Immunotherapy and Allergy Treatments: Injections in subcutaneous or intramuscular injections can be used to administer immunotherapy treatments that slowly desensitize patients to specific allergens or immunotherapy drugs. Precision syringe needles are crucial for delivering these injections accurately and minimizing patient discomfort
  • Insulin Delivery: People with diabetes depend on insulin delivery to manage their blood sugar levels. Syringe needles are used to inject insulin subcutaneously. Some individuals prefer insulin pens, which have interchangeable cartridges.
  • Biologic and Specialty Drug Injections: As biologic and specialty drugs are often administered via syringe needles, precise delivery is crucial when giving high-cost, targeted therapies like monoclonal antibodies. Biologics are medications derived from living organisms, and they encompass a wide range of products, including vaccines, blood components, hormones, and antibodies. Examples include treatments for rheumatoid arthritis, psoriasis, inflammatory bowel disease, and certain types of cancer. Biologic drugs are usually delivered directly into the patient's bloodstream through intravenous (IV) infusion or injected under the skin (subcutaneously) using a syringe. Subcutaneous injections are preferred for some biologics because they are easier for patients to self-administer, and they provide a slower, more consistent release of the medication than intravenous infusions. Q3: What is the difference between a needle and a cannula?

A3: A syringe needle is a sharp instrument used to extract liquid from the body or inject substances into the body. A cannula is a thin tube inserted into the body to receive medication or extract fluids. Cannulas can be used in conjunction with needles.

Q4: What are the potential hazards associated with expired syringes and needles?

A4: Using expired syringes and needles can have dangerous health complications. They may deliver inaccurate doses and cause obstructed injections, broken needles, or infected injection sites. In some cases, they may lead to blood contamination.
